## Goods Lift — Deliveries Only

Quick reminder for reception at Thornefield Place: the goods lift by the rear dock is strictly for deliveries, not for staff running late to meetings (yes, people try). When a courier arrives, sign them in, ring the facilities line, and escort them to the dock doors. The lift call panel is keypad-locked outside delivery hours, so don't share access casually. For authorised deliveries, use the code below.

staff pass of kawip-hawef = bdg-QLP-2

## Changelog — Ticktrace 1.9

### Renamed: DRIFT_API_TOKEN
During the cron drift investigation we found plugins confusing this variable with the metrics token, so it has been renamed to indicate it authorizes drift-report uploads specifically. Plugin authors must read the new name from 1.9 onward; the old name is ignored without warning. Sample env files in the SDK are updated. In your deployment env file, the drift-report upload secret is set on the next line.

env line for fawef-taguf: VAULT_KEY13=a9695905a9a90

MEMO TO THE BOARD — Flintmere Launch

Quick update on the Flintmere Desk launch. We're targeting early spring, with a soft rollout in the Kestrel Bay region first. Marketing under Davo Renwick has the teaser campaign ready, and support staffing is trained up. Pricing tiers are locked, though we're keeping the premium bundle flexible until we see early demand. Honestly, the team's morale is great and we're ahead of schedule. The confidential note on our broader plans appears directly below.

internal memo for hafog-hadug: The pricing group signed off on a budget of $16.1 million for Project Gorir. The renewal with Oliionax Systems closes at $14.1 million a year, 46 percent above the last contract.

## Changelog — Gearlane CI 7.1, skew defaults

We changed the default clock-skew tolerance between build agents from 30 seconds to 5 seconds after the Pellworth agents were moved to disciplined NTP. Builds from agents outside tolerance are now quarantined rather than silently accepted, so support may see new "skew quarantine" tickets. The enforcement settings now shipping by default are listed below.

service settings:
novath:
  pin: 1396
  tenant: pelys
  seal: seal_ccc035e1
  metrics_host: metrics.novath.qorvelworks.test
  standby_team: fraeth
  escalation: drueth-zorok
  nonce: 61d508